Senior Massage Therapist Salary in Coeur d'Alene, ID: $89,171 (2026)
Quick Answer:The top tier of massage therapists working in Coeur d'Alene, ID —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$89,171/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 31-9011. Strip back Coeur d'Alene's price premium (BEA RPP 98.3, 2% below national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$90,720 in average-cost America. The 37%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

Maximizing Your Massage Therapist Earnings in Coeur d'Alene
In Coeur d'Alene, senior massage therapists can enhance their earning potential by specializing in modalities such as deep tissue, prenatal massage, and oncology massage, each commanding premiums in competitive markets. The compensation landscape varies significantly based on the type of employer; for instance, therapists in high-end hotel and cruise ship spas typically earn more than those in franchise chains like Massage Envy, where pay structures often lean heavily on service rates rather than hourly pay. Advancement opportunities abound for seasoned professionals, offering paths to leadership roles such as spa supervisor or owner of a mobile practice. Additionally, attaining advanced certifications and completing state-approved programs can further boost pay, as can membership in professional organizations like ABMP or AMTA. Factors such as tips, which can account for 15-25% of service fees at specialized spas, and the option for self-employment—often resulting in a much higher hourly income—also contribute to the financial dynamics of senior massage therapist pay in ID.
